Manager - Site Specific Layout

Role: Manager – Site-Specific Layout & Installations

Locations: Hybrid working with one of the following closest locations as primary: Derby, Warrington or Manchester


Our Mission

Our mission is to deliver clean, affordable energy for all. Our Small Modular Reactor (SMR) provides a British solution to a global energy challenge. We are in pole position to become a global leader in SMRs and the UK’s premier green export technology.


The Team

Within Engineering, the CSA Installation & Modular Integration team plays a pivotal role in translating complex design into buildable, site-ready solutions. Operating at the heart of engineering integration, the team drives innovation across:

  • Layout
  • Constructability
  • Modularisation

to enable efficient, safe, and repeatable deployment.


The Role

Reporting to the Senior Manager (Reactor Island Layout), the Manager – Site-Specific Layout & Installations will lead a team of circa six engineers to deliver:

  • Site-specific Reactor Island layouts, derived from the Generic Design
  • Deployment support for both the UK and Czechia

This is a highly visible, integration-focused role with responsibility for:

  • Developing layout solutions that interpret country-specific regulatory requirements
  • Coordinating multidisciplinary inputs
  • Ensuring designs are optimised for constructability, safety, and operational performance

The role is pivotal in enabling licensing success while shaping scalable and repeatable design solutions across multiple sites.


What You’ll Be Delivering

  • Lead integrated delivery of site-specific Reactor Island layouts, translating the generic design intent into compliant, buildable solutions
  • Coordinate multidisciplinary teams across:
    • Structures
    • Systems
    • Components
    • Conventional Island to deliver fully integrated outcomes
  • Own configuration, requirements, and variant management, ensuring robust governance and traceability of the design evolution
  • Manage the federated CAD model for Reactor Island and align it with:
    • Architecture
    • Access
    • Safety
    • Zoning strategies
  • Develop and own delivery plans, managing risk and performance against cost, quality, and schedule goals
  • Build and lead a high-performing team to:
    • Support capability growth
    • Facilitate coaching
    • Effectively deploy resources

What You’ll Bring

This pivotal, high-impact leadership role requires technical credibility, systems thinking, and delivery focus. Additional critical attributes include:

  • Qualification: Degree in Mechanical, Electrical Engineering, or a closely related discipline, preferably with Chartered status (or close to attaining it)

  • Experience:

    • Delivering complex layout or installation design programmes from concept to detailed design
    • Operating within regulated environments
    • Strong systems engineering, requirements management (e.g., DOORS), configuration control, and gated design review experience
    • Leading engineering teams in multidisciplinary settings
    • Managing technical and programme risk
  • Advantageous:

    • Awareness of nuclear or highly regulated industry standards
    • Exposure to international codes and regulations

Location

Offers hybrid flexibility across primary locations:

  • Derby
  • Manchester
  • Warrington

Regular in-person collaboration is essential, with occasional travel required to:

  • UK offices
  • Customer locations
  • International sites

What’s in It for You

  • Salary Range: £60,000 - £78,750 per annum (including opportunity for performance-related bonuses)
  • Allowance: £2,200 per annum (to create a bespoke package)
  • Pension: 12% employer contribution + 6% employee contribution
  • Holidays: 28 days of annual leave (including public holidays) with flexibility to buy or sell up to 4 days
  • Private Medical Insurance: BUPA single-cover health care
  • Life Assurance: 6x pensionable salary

Selection Process

  • Initial conversation with the Talent Acquisition team
  • Followed by multi-stage interviews with the hiring team
  • Mandatory pre-employment checks due to safety clearance requirements within the nuclear industry:
    • BPSS clearance
    • DBS check
    • Financial probity check
